i'm getting rid of my gas hog truck and buying an sti in about a month. my friend has a done up wrx, but has done nothing to the sound and it's absolutely horrible. i want to take the two 10 inch subs and a 10 inch 500 watt amp out of my truck and put them into the sti in a new smaller box. how much would this weight affect the performance of that car?
Probably not enough to worry about it unless you're racing, besides, having more weight in rear might help with the balance of the car.
3298 lbs (stock STi)/300=10.99 lbs/hp
3375 lbs (stock STi w/ subs and amp)/300=11.25 lbs/hp
Have heard that adding 100 lbs adds .1 seconds to quarter mile times
